A distressing case of Love Jihad has come to light from the Raebareli district of Uttar Pradesh. Here, a minor Hindu girl was trapped into a relationship by a man identified as Tauheed but posed as a Hindu named Janu Mishra. When the girl discovered Tauheed’s true identity, she tragically took her own life.

The girl’s father has since filed an FIR, alleging that Tauheed, along with his brother and father, had been threatening their family.

The accused have been identified as Tauheed, his brother Tasleem alias Chhotu, and their father Lallan, all residents of Jainapur Majre Kheero in Raebareli.

An FIR (Number 0283/2024) was registered on July 15, 2024, at Kheero Police Station under sections 306 (abetment of suicide), 504 (intentional insult with intent to provoke breach of the peace), and 506 (criminal intimidation)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ita.

Organiser called Kheero Station House Officer (SHO) Yashodevan Bhadoriya confirmed that the prime accused, Tauheed, was arrested on July 16 and subsequently presented before the court. The minor girl has already recorded her statement with the police and is scheduled to give her statement in court on July 16.

Ram Prakash Tiwari, the father of the victim, told the police that his daughter was a student in the 11th grade at Saraswati Inter College in Kheero. Around a year ago, Tauheed, using the false identity of Janu Mishra, approached the minor on her way to school. Tiwari’s younger daughter informed him about the situation.

The complaint details how Tauheed trapped the girl in a love affair under the guise of being a Hindu.

Upon learning his true identity, the girl committed suicide on February 1 of this year. At the time, the police conducted Panchayat Nama proceedings, but no further action was taken.

When Tiwari confronted Tauheed’s family about the incident, Tauheed, his brother Tasleem, and their father Lallan allegedly threatened and chased him away, warning him not to file a case. Fearing for his safety, Tiwari initially hesitated but has now filed a formal complaint, urging the police to take action.

Tiwari, accompanied by several men, confronted Tauheed and discovered his true identity as a Muslim from Jainapur. Despite urged by some to avoid conflict for the sake of his daughter’s future, Tiwari pursued legal action due to continuous threats and harassment.

The younger sister mentioned that after her sister’s suicide, the police assured the family they would take action but have yet to follow through. The family continues to face threats while awaiting justice.

Speaking with Organiser on July 16, Ram Prakash Tiwari revealed that his troubles began back in March 2020 when he took a stand against illegal cow smuggling for slaughter. The accused in that case were Mohammad Azad, Akbar, and others. Since then, Tiwari has been subjected to continuous threats from the Muslim community in his locality. The cow smugglers had slaughtered multiple cows at the time, and Tiwari not only lodged a complaint but ensured the arrest of the accused.

After the arrests, Tiwari’s family faced a series of harrowing events. His younger daughter narrowly survived an accident involving a pickup truck. Soon after, his elder daughter became ensnared in a deceitful relationship with Tauheed, whose relatives had been arrested for cow smuggling. Tiwari himself has been on the receiving end of numerous threats.

Tiwari has demanded that the accused be charged under sections of the POCSO Act, given the involvement of a minor in the case.
